Practical and Memorable: Choosing the Right Sticky Notes for Corporate Events



Sticky notes are a staple in office environments, known for their practicality and versatility. At corporate events, promotional sticky notes can serve as effective branded giveaways that attendees will actually use. With endless customisation options, sticky notes are both practical and memorable, helping your brand stand out in subtle but impactful ways. Here’s a guide to choosing the best types of sticky notes, including memo cubes and twisters, for your next corporate event.

1. Promotional Memo Cubes and Twisters for a Unique Touch

Memo cubes and sticky note twisters are eye-catching and practical, making them standout promotional items for corporate events. Unlike standard sticky note pads, memo cubes offer multiple sides for branding, while twisters are fun, interactive items that capture attention. These unique products add an element of novelty and can create a memorable brand experience for attendees.

Benefits of Promotional Memo Cubes and Twisters:

  • Enhanced Branding Space: Memo cubes provide branding on all sides, allowing for a bold, impactful presentation of your logo and message.
  • Interactive Appeal: Twisters add a playful element that keeps your brand top of mind as attendees twist and use the notes.
  • Desk-Ready Design: Both memo cubes and twisters are likely to find a permanent spot on desks, offering consistent brand exposure.

2. Branded Sticky Note Pads for Everyday Use

Classic sticky note pads are an excellent choice for corporate events. These small yet functional items offer a consistent reminder of your brand and are widely appreciated by event attendees. Custom sticky note pads allow you to showcase your logo, slogan, or even your brand colours, providing a long-lasting impression.

Why Sticky Note Pads Work for Corporate Events:

  • Functionality: Sticky notes are always useful for jotting down reminders, marking pages, and leaving quick notes.
  • Portability: Compact and lightweight, sticky note pads are easy to hand out at events and easy for attendees to take home.
  • Visibility: With your brand logo on each sheet, sticky notes ensure frequent visibility every time they’re used.

3. Eco-Friendly Sticky Notes to Showcase Sustainability

With sustainability at the forefront of many companies' priorities, eco-friendly sticky notes are a great option for organisations aiming to make an environmentally conscious statement. Made from recycled materials or featuring biodegradable adhesive, eco-friendly sticky notes allow companies to align with eco-conscious values and attract like-minded attendees.

Eco-Friendly Options for a Positive Impact:

  • Recycled Paper Pads: Sticky notes made from recycled paper offer a greener option and still maintain a high-quality look and feel.
  • Biodegradable Adhesives: Choosing sticky notes with biodegradable adhesives reflects your commitment to reducing environmental impact.
  • Minimalist Designs: Opt for simple designs that align with sustainable values and highlight your brand’s eco-friendly approach.

4. Custom-Shaped Sticky Notes for a Memorable Impression

Custom-shaped sticky notes allow for creativity and can make your brand instantly recognisable. Shapes that reflect your industry—like a light bulb for a tech company or a coffee cup for a café—add a personal touch and make the sticky notes more memorable. Custom shapes help reinforce brand identity in a way that’s fun and visually appealing.

Ideas for Custom-Shaped Sticky Notes:

  • Industry-Specific Shapes: Select a shape that aligns with your brand, like a house shape for real estate or a car shape for an automotive brand.
  • Seasonal or Themed Shapes: If your event has a specific theme, choose shapes that complement it, like holiday-themed notes or event-related symbols.
  • Compact and Functional: Ensure the shape remains practical for everyday use, as functional sticky notes are more likely to be retained and used.

5. Sticky Note Booklets for Organised and Professional Branding

Sticky note booklets offer a more premium feel and are perfect for corporate events where you want to make a strong, professional impression. These booklets typically include a variety of sticky note sizes and colours, all bound within a branded cover. They’re ideal for attendees who want a well-organised way to take notes and leave reminders, adding a level of sophistication to your promotional items.

Advantages of Sticky Note Booklets:

  • Multiple Note Options: Booklets often include different sizes, allowing for versatile use and added functionality.
  • Branded Cover: The cover provides additional space for your logo, slogan, and brand colours, ensuring maximum visibility.
  • Professional Look: Booklets have a high-quality appearance that’s ideal for corporate settings and reflects positively on your brand.

6. Sticky Note Holders for Long-Term Brand Exposure

Sticky note holders are practical items that are both decorative and useful. These holders often include space for sticky notes and pens, making them perfect for desks. Attendees are likely to place them in their workspace, providing ongoing brand exposure every time they’re used.

Why Sticky Note Holders Are Effective:

  • Desk Appeal: Sticky note holders have a desk-friendly design, ensuring your brand remains visible in daily work settings.
  • Extended Use: Holders keep sticky notes neat and accessible, making them a staple for busy professionals.
  • Customization Options: Personalise holders with your logo and choose from various colours and materials to fit your brand aesthetic.


Conclusion

Sticky notes are a practical and memorable promotional product choice for corporate events, offering daily brand visibility in workspaces everywhere. From classic sticky note pads and eco-friendly options to unique memo cubes, twisters, and custom-shaped notes, there’s a style to suit every brand and event. By choosing sticky notes that align with your brand identity and the needs of your audience, you can make a lasting impact that keeps your organisation top of mind long after the event ends.
